    Overview As a student in Brass - Trombone from University of North Carolina School of the Arts you will receive private lessons from faculty members who are also active musicians in all genres, giving you exposure to a wide range of playing styles, music and experiences. Your weekly studio master classes will give you the chance to perform in front of your peers, allowing you to learn – from your own performance as well as your colleagues’ – how to both give and receive critical feedback. CareersThe brass program at UNCSA has been a springboard for many of its graduates’ professional careers and education. Graduates have pursed advanced degrees at prestigious institutions like the Manhattan School of Music and Indiana University in Bloomington, completed fellowships at Lincoln Center and studied musicology in Vienna. Others are part of ensembles, like the local Camel City Jazz Orchestra and Giannini Brass Quintet, Shen Yun Symphony Orchestra and ceremonial bands in the United States military.
